Keep the Combustion Chamber Clean

A catalytic combustor functioning properly will appear to be like a powdery gray. It should be free of soot, ash or any other material that could plug up the catalytic surfaces and reduce their surface area. The combustor must not be subject to impingement of flames. This could occur when a strong, rapid draft draws flames directly into a catalytic converter. This could also occur if you leave the firebox and ash pan doors open.
